Synopsis |
16 |
======== |
17 |
|
18 |
Multiple vulnerabilities have been discovered in OpenSSL, the worst of |
19 |
which could result in remote code execution. |
20 |
|
21 |
Background |
22 |
========== |
23 |
|
24 |
OpenSSL is an Open Source toolkit implementing the Secure Sockets Layer |
25 |
(SSL v2/v3) and Transport Layer Security (TLS v1) as well as a general |
26 |
purpose cryptography library. |
27 |
|
28 |
Affected packages |
29 |
================= |
30 |
|
31 |
------------------------------------------------------------------- |
32 |
Package / Vulnerable / Unaffected |
33 |
------------------------------------------------------------------- |
34 |
1 dev-libs/openssl < 3.0.7:0/3 >= 3.0.7:0/3 |
35 |
|
36 |
Description |
37 |
=========== |
38 |
|
39 |
Multiple buffer overflows exist in OpenSSL's handling of TLS |
40 |
certificates for client authentication. |
41 |
|
42 |
Impact |
43 |
====== |
44 |
|
45 |
It is believed that, while unlikely, code execution is possible in |
46 |
certain system configurations. |
47 |
|
48 |
Workaround |
49 |
========== |
50 |
|
51 |
Users operating TLS servers may consider disabling TLS client |
52 |
authentication, if it is being used, until fixes are applied. |
53 |
|
54 |
Resolution |
55 |
========== |
56 |
|
57 |
All OpenSSL 3 users should upgrade to the latest version: |
58 |
|
59 |
# emerge --sync |
60 |
# em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ose ">=dev-libs/openssl-3.0.7" |
